Remove BRIG front-end.
gcc/ada/ChangeLog: * gcc-interface/ada-tree.h (BUILT_IN_LIKELY): Use builtins from COROUTINES. (BUILT_IN_UNLIKELY): Likewise. gcc/ChangeLog: * builtins.def (DEF_HSAIL_BUILTIN): Remove. (DEF_HSAIL_ATOMIC_BUILTIN): Likewise. (DEF_HSAIL_SAT_BUILTIN): Likewise. (DEF_HSAIL_INTR_BUILTIN): Likewise. (DEF_HSAIL_CVT_ZEROI_SAT_BUILTIN): Likewise. * doc/frontends.texi: Remove BRIG. * doc/install.texi: Likewise. * doc/invoke.texi: Likewise. * doc/standards.texi: Likewise. * brig-builtins.def: Removed. * brig/ChangeLog: Removed. * brig/Make-lang.in: Removed. * brig/brig-builtins.h: Removed. * brig/brig-c.h: Removed. * brig/brig-lang.c: Removed. * brig/brigfrontend/brig-arg-block-handler.cc: Removed. * brig/brigfrontend/brig-atomic-inst-handler.cc: Removed. * brig/brigfrontend/brig-basic-inst-handler.cc: Removed. * brig/brigfrontend/brig-branch-inst-handler.cc: Removed. * brig/brigfrontend/brig-cmp-inst-handler.cc: Removed. * brig/brigfrontend/brig-code-entry-handler.cc: Removed. * brig/brigfrontend/brig-code-entry-handler.h: Removed. * brig/brigfrontend/brig-comment-handler.cc: Removed. * brig/brigfrontend/brig-control-handler.cc: Removed. * brig/brigfrontend/brig-copy-move-inst-handler.cc: Removed. * brig/brigfrontend/brig-cvt-inst-handler.cc: Removed. * brig/brigfrontend/brig-fbarrier-handler.cc: Removed. * brig/brigfrontend/brig-function-handler.cc: Removed. * brig/brigfrontend/brig-function.cc: Removed. * brig/brigfrontend/brig-function.h: Removed. * brig/brigfrontend/brig-inst-mod-handler.cc: Removed. * brig/brigfrontend/brig-label-handler.cc: Removed. * brig/brigfrontend/brig-lane-inst-handler.cc: Removed. * brig/brigfrontend/brig-machine.c: Removed. * brig/brigfrontend/brig-machine.h: Removed. * brig/brigfrontend/brig-mem-inst-handler.cc: Removed. * brig/brigfrontend/brig-module-handler.cc: Removed. * brig/brigfrontend/brig-queue-inst-handler.cc: Removed. * brig/brigfrontend/brig-seg-inst-handler.cc: Removed. * brig/brigfrontend/brig-signal-inst-handler.cc: Removed. * brig/brigfrontend/brig-to-generic.cc: Removed. * brig/brigfrontend/brig-to-generic.h: Removed. * brig/brigfrontend/brig-util.cc: Removed. * brig/brigfrontend/brig-util.h: Removed. * brig/brigfrontend/brig-variable-handler.cc: Removed. * brig/brigfrontend/hsa-brig-format.h: Removed. * brig/brigfrontend/phsa.h: Removed. * brig/brigspec.c: Removed. * brig/config-lang.in: Removed. * brig/gccbrig.texi: Removed. * brig/lang-specs.h: Removed. * brig/lang.opt: Removed. gcc/testsuite/ChangeLog: * gfortran.dg/goacc/pr78027.f90: Remove -Wno-hsa option. * brig.dg/README: Removed. * brig.dg/dg.exp: Removed. * brig.dg/test/gimple/alloca.hsail: Removed. * brig.dg/test/gimple/atomics.hsail: Removed. * brig.dg/test/gimple/branches.hsail: Removed. * brig.dg/test/gimple/fbarrier.hsail: Removed. * brig.dg/test/gimple/function_calls.hsail: Removed. * brig.dg/test/gimple/internal-casts.hsail: Removed. * brig.dg/test/gimple/kernarg.hsail: Removed. * brig.dg/test/gimple/mem.hsail: Removed. * brig.dg/test/gimple/mulhi.hsail: Removed. * brig.dg/test/gimple/packed.hsail: Removed. * brig.dg/test/gimple/priv-array-offset-access.hsail: Removed. * brig.dg/test/gimple/smoke_test.hsail: Removed. * brig.dg/test/gimple/variables.hsail: Removed. * brig.dg/test/gimple/vector.hsail: Removed. * lib/brig-dg.exp: Removed. * lib/brig.exp: Removed.
Showing
- gcc/ada/gcc-interface/ada-tree.h 3 additions, 3 deletionsgcc/ada/gcc-interface/ada-tree.h
- gcc/brig-builtins.def 0 additions, 675 deletionsgcc/brig-builtins.def
- gcc/brig/ChangeLog 0 additions, 433 deletionsgcc/brig/ChangeLog
- gcc/brig/Make-lang.in 0 additions, 251 deletionsgcc/brig/Make-lang.in
- gcc/brig/brig-builtins.h 0 additions, 99 deletionsgcc/brig/brig-builtins.h
- gcc/brig/brig-c.h 0 additions, 66 deletionsgcc/brig/brig-c.h
- gcc/brig/brig-lang.c 0 additions, 958 deletionsgcc/brig/brig-lang.c
- gcc/brig/brigfrontend/brig-arg-block-handler.cc 0 additions, 66 deletionsgcc/brig/brigfrontend/brig-arg-block-handler.cc
- gcc/brig/brigfrontend/brig-atomic-inst-handler.cc 0 additions, 265 deletionsgcc/brig/brigfrontend/brig-atomic-inst-handler.cc
- gcc/brig/brigfrontend/brig-basic-inst-handler.cc 0 additions, 735 deletionsgcc/brig/brigfrontend/brig-basic-inst-handler.cc
- gcc/brig/brigfrontend/brig-branch-inst-handler.cc 0 additions, 238 deletionsgcc/brig/brigfrontend/brig-branch-inst-handler.cc
- gcc/brig/brigfrontend/brig-cmp-inst-handler.cc 0 additions, 198 deletionsgcc/brig/brigfrontend/brig-cmp-inst-handler.cc
- gcc/brig/brigfrontend/brig-code-entry-handler.cc 0 additions, 1305 deletionsgcc/brig/brigfrontend/brig-code-entry-handler.cc
- gcc/brig/brigfrontend/brig-code-entry-handler.h 0 additions, 410 deletionsgcc/brig/brigfrontend/brig-code-entry-handler.h
- gcc/brig/brigfrontend/brig-comment-handler.cc 0 additions, 38 deletionsgcc/brig/brigfrontend/brig-comment-handler.cc
- gcc/brig/brigfrontend/brig-control-handler.cc 0 additions, 108 deletionsgcc/brig/brigfrontend/brig-control-handler.cc
- gcc/brig/brigfrontend/brig-copy-move-inst-handler.cc 0 additions, 73 deletionsgcc/brig/brigfrontend/brig-copy-move-inst-handler.cc
- gcc/brig/brigfrontend/brig-cvt-inst-handler.cc 0 additions, 268 deletionsgcc/brig/brigfrontend/brig-cvt-inst-handler.cc
- gcc/brig/brigfrontend/brig-fbarrier-handler.cc 0 additions, 45 deletionsgcc/brig/brigfrontend/brig-fbarrier-handler.cc
- gcc/brig/brigfrontend/brig-function-handler.cc 0 additions, 431 deletionsgcc/brig/brigfrontend/brig-function-handler.cc
Loading
Please register or sign in to comment